2010-08-10 24 views
78

Hace algunos días, mi Eclipse funcionaba bien y aparecía un +/- en cada bloque que podía colapsar (funciones, clases, etc.) ... pero ahora sí aparece y no sé cómo activarlo. función de nuevo.Cómo colapsar bloques de código en Eclipse?

Es Eclipse Helios, que se ejecuta en una caja de Gentoo Linux.

+1

En Preferencias -> C++ -> Editor -> Plegable hay una casilla de verificación: "Habilitar el plegado de instrucciones de flujo de control". Es posible que no vea nada inmediatamente porque el cálculo de los puntos de plegado puede suceder lentamente en segundo plano, o puede ser necesario invocar el comando "Restablecer estructura" shift + ctrl + numpad_multiplicar, para que eclipse muestre todos los puntos de plegado. –

Respuesta

83

Preferencias -> C++ -> Editor -> Plegable?

Haga clic con el botón derecho en la ventana del editor y vaya a las preferencias allí, luego solo aparecerá la sección relevante para el editor del cuadro de diálogo de preferencias. Esto funciona para JDT, CDT, etc ...

+9

Otra forma es hacer clic derecho en la barra vertical estrecha que tiene todos los (+)/(-) pequeños más y menos. La opción de doblar el código estará allí. – Anonsage

+1

En el Eclipse actual, no veo ninguna opción de "Plegado" debajo del editor para cada idioma. En cambio, la respuesta de @KennyPeng es lo que funciona para mí. – ToolmakerSteve

17

probar esta opción: Preferencias> Java> Editor> plegable> Habilitar plegable

46

Usted puede hacer Ctrl + NUMPAD_DIVIDE para permitir el plegado. Además, si hace clic derecho en el área donde se suponía que estaba +/-, puede ver que hay una opción de plegado.

+7

Esa opción está seleccionada y funciona, pero quiero doblar para If/else y cambiar de estuche ... ¿Cómo puedo obtener eso? – aProgrammer

+0

¿Recibió la respuesta si doblando Amit? Lo estoy buscando también en eclipse. –

+0

C + S + Num/- hace un colapso todo. Accidentalmente presioné C +/- y no volví a doblar el código. ¡Gracias, esto ayudó a recuperarlo! – Gishu

3

Supongo que está utilizando Java, pero mire en la configuración de su idioma particular.

En el menú Ventana, seleccione Preferencias.

En Java-> Editor-> Plegable. Seleccione "Activar plegado".

+3

Esa opción está seleccionada y funciona, pero quiero doblar para If/else y cambiar de estuche ... ¿Cómo puedo obtener eso? – aProgrammer

+0

@Amit por lo que sé, no se puede. – ApproachingDarknessFish

+0

En Preferencias -> C++ -> Editor -> Plegable hay una casilla de verificación: "Habilitar plegado de instrucciones de flujo de control". –

6

En Preferencias, encontrará General> Claves. Es para configurar los atajos de teclado.

Sin embargo, para lo que lo uso con más frecuencia es para encontrar cosas en Eclipse. Debería ver un cuadro de entrada etiquetado como "escriba texto de filtro". Es lo más cerca que llega Eclipse a una función de búsqueda para cada comando de Eclipse.

1

Si desea plegar un todas sus editores, encontré puede activar plegable en

Preferencias> Editores> Structured editores de texto

¿Quieres habilitar plegable

8

Para Python es como sigue:

  • Reducir todo 1 nivel: Ctrl +
  • expandir todo 1 nivel: Ctrl +
  • actual colapso: Ctrl + -
  • expandir actual: Ctrl + +

Espero que ayude .

8

Para contraer todos los bloques de código Ctrl + Shift + /

Para expandir todos los bloques de código Ctrl + Shift + *

pydev:

para contraer todos los bloques de código: Ctrl +

Para contraer todos los bloques de código: Ctrl +

Is there a way to collapse all code blocks in Eclipse?

por @partizanos y @bummi

+0

esta debería ser la respuesta aceptada –

0

En CFEclipse: Preferencias> CFEclipse> Editor> Plegado de código> Columna Inicialmente contraer, puede desmarcar para ver todo expandido al abrir, o marcar todos los cuadros para cerrar todo al abrir un archivo.

0

Estaba usando clases Apex de Salesforce con Eclipse Neon 3.3 para Java.
Encontré una opción "definir la región de plegado" al hacer clic derecho en el editor, seleccioné el bloque de código que quería colapsar y seleccioné esta propiedad para ese código. Ahora estoy viendo + y - símbolo para expandir y contraer ese bloque de código

0

Para ventanas Eclipse mediante java: Windows -> Preferencias -> Java -> Editor -> plegable

Desafortunadamente esto no va a permitir el colapso código, sin embargo, si se apaga, puede volver a habilitarlo para deshacerse de los comentarios largos y las importaciones.

+0

Lo siento, me di cuenta poco después de publicar que alguien ya lo señaló, elimínelo. – Elijah

+2

¿Por qué no eliminas tu propia publicación? –

Cuestiones relacionadas